Hi Aces, this is just a guide for who wants to run Battle of Britain Wings of Victory 2 on Windows 8.1 with Max Video Settings with no Crashes.
First is important to know that the main problems are not exactly related to DirectX9 dll files but incompatible codes inserted to bob.exe or muParser.dll in Patches 2.02 to 2.13
So it means the game will run perfectly with Max Settings using Patch 2.01
So follow the procedures bellow to install BOB2 and run it without CTDs (Crashes to Desktop):
1-Download and Install DirectX 9.0c (June 2010 redistributable)
2-Install original BoB2 Game
3-Download and Install BOB2 Patch 2.01 (The only one compatible with Windows 8.1)
Download Link:
https://www.moddb.com/games/battle-of-b ... tch-2-01-6
4-After installing the Patch Delete the folder "ObjectAdds" inside your game folder at "C:\Battle of Britain II" (Cause this folder makes your aircraft crash and explode on ground due invisible ground object collisions)
5-Always run "bob.exe" as Administrator and in Compatibility Mode "Windows XP (Service Pack 2)" or "Windows XP (Service Pack 3)" (Or else you may have mute radio chat sounds and other bugs)
6-On Game Main Menu go to Options / Menu / Controls / Key Mapping
Find "EXITKEY"
And then Clear Alt+X command and replace it to another key of your choice like "J" for example, then click save. (It helps in case your Windows uses Alt+X for some system shortcut command causing the game to crash)
7-(Optional) Only if your Windows is x64 (64-bits) download software "4GB Patch" and apply it to your "bob.exe" file so your game will use 4GB RAM instead only 2GB.
Download Link:
https://ntcore.com/?page_id=371
Well that is it, maybe it also works for Windows 8 or 10 but I didn't test. I can only ensure full stability for windows 8.1
Have fun!
Guide to Run BOB2 Perfectly with Max Settings on Windows 8.1
Guide to Run BOB2 Perfectly with Max Settings on Windows 8.1
Last edited by Felizpe on 08 Feb 2019, 18:25, edited 1 time in total.
"Just wanna live enough to tell my grandson I was a BOB2 Ace"
Re: Guide to Run BOB2 Perfectly with Max Settings on Windows
Hi Felizpe
I run windows 7 but do appreciate you taking the time to post a guide for 8.1 here.
I run windows 7 but do appreciate you taking the time to post a guide for 8.1 here.
hellcat
Re: Guide to Run BOB2 Perfectly with Max Settings on Windows
Your wellcome hellcat44!
I hope some BoB2 Patcher Developer could check what code or file was inserted to 2.02 that was not present in 2.01 that made the game unstable on modern systems making the game crash in almost all missions after some seconds. I can see muParser.dll as I said but can't check the inner codes of bob.exe. Generally the game crashes when you target large amount of objects like an airfield from the air or when you get near heavy bomber formations. So the problem is related to Objects Loading due some new code or new dll inserted. Cause using patch 2.01 I can play Historic Instant Mission "Eagle Day" with max planes, using max Video Settings and I never had a single crash, I think I played it already a hundred times. Using patch 2.02 my game crashes even playing at "Take Off" Tutorial Instant Mission, always when I am in the air targeting the whole airfield. Playing "Eagle Day" mission using patch 2.02 to 2.13 it will always crash as I get near the bomber formations, don't matter if I change to Low everything in options video settings. I have a felling it can be easly solved, i'ts just necessary to find what was added in patch 2.02 that was not present in 2.01 version
I hope some BoB2 Patcher Developer could check what code or file was inserted to 2.02 that was not present in 2.01 that made the game unstable on modern systems making the game crash in almost all missions after some seconds. I can see muParser.dll as I said but can't check the inner codes of bob.exe. Generally the game crashes when you target large amount of objects like an airfield from the air or when you get near heavy bomber formations. So the problem is related to Objects Loading due some new code or new dll inserted. Cause using patch 2.01 I can play Historic Instant Mission "Eagle Day" with max planes, using max Video Settings and I never had a single crash, I think I played it already a hundred times. Using patch 2.02 my game crashes even playing at "Take Off" Tutorial Instant Mission, always when I am in the air targeting the whole airfield. Playing "Eagle Day" mission using patch 2.02 to 2.13 it will always crash as I get near the bomber formations, don't matter if I change to Low everything in options video settings. I have a felling it can be easly solved, i'ts just necessary to find what was added in patch 2.02 that was not present in 2.01 version
"Just wanna live enough to tell my grandson I was a BOB2 Ace"
-
- Airman
- Posts: 26
- Joined: 06 Dec 2017, 17:46
Re: Guide to Run BOB2 Perfectly with Max Settings on Windows
While I do share your hope it's not going to happen. They stopped developing BoB2 any further - which is a real pitty...I hope some BoB2 Patcher Developer could check what code or file was inserted to 2.02 that was not present in 2.01 that made the game unstable on modern systems making the game crash in almost all missions after some seconds.
PS
But I'll be giving your approach a try I think ^^
Re: Guide to Run BOB2 Perfectly with Max Settings on Windows
Hi Eisenfaust, but are all the volunteer patch guys gonne too? Everybody killed in action so??? Hope some old ace legend is still alive, but I don't want to pressure anybody since I'm satisfied playing patch 2.01 on my windows 8.1. It's just more a question of making these latest great patches compatible to new windows versions
Well in Patch 2.02 read me file it's written:
Changes from v2.01 to 2.02
- Improved framerate (fps). The effect is most marked with weather low and on
computers that suffer from low fps.
- New bdg.txt variable INVERT_EXTERNAL_PAN - inverts pan direction in external
view
- New bdg.txt variable NO_FOV_RESET - disables resetting of FOV in when
resetting the view (via ROTRESET/ROTRESET2/AROTRESET)
- TrackIR 6dof z-axis overrides any analog axis setting.
- Made stick POV hat user mappable
- Ju88 engine texture fix.
- In the OPTIONS screen, changed the name REFLECTIONS to MIRROR
- Enhanced explosion and flak sounds.
- More realistic Browning .303 sounds (increased rate of fire).
Patch 2.02 can still be downloaded here:
https://www.moddb.com/games/battle-of-b ... patch-2-02
But it doesn't explain the purpose of this muParser.dll, and don't list all codes inserted to bob.exe, so I think only the guys with acess to the inner codes can fix this problem...
Well in Patch 2.02 read me file it's written:
Changes from v2.01 to 2.02
- Improved framerate (fps). The effect is most marked with weather low and on
computers that suffer from low fps.
- New bdg.txt variable INVERT_EXTERNAL_PAN - inverts pan direction in external
view
- New bdg.txt variable NO_FOV_RESET - disables resetting of FOV in when
resetting the view (via ROTRESET/ROTRESET2/AROTRESET)
- TrackIR 6dof z-axis overrides any analog axis setting.
- Made stick POV hat user mappable
- Ju88 engine texture fix.
- In the OPTIONS screen, changed the name REFLECTIONS to MIRROR
- Enhanced explosion and flak sounds.
- More realistic Browning .303 sounds (increased rate of fire).
Patch 2.02 can still be downloaded here:
https://www.moddb.com/games/battle-of-b ... patch-2-02
But it doesn't explain the purpose of this muParser.dll, and don't list all codes inserted to bob.exe, so I think only the guys with acess to the inner codes can fix this problem...
"Just wanna live enough to tell my grandson I was a BOB2 Ace"
Re: Guide to Run BOB2 Perfectly with Max Settings on Windows
Good News, found out today what is causing the game to crash on Windows 8/8.1/10
The problem is simply the file "bob.exe" from patches 2.02 to 2.13
I'm sure the addition of one of these 3 following codes to "bob.exe" is making the game to crash:
TRACKIR6DOF
INVERT_EXTERNAL_PAN
NO_FOV_RESET
Cause if you install patch 2.02 but use with it the "bob.exe" file from patch 2.01 the game runs perfectly. (But when you exit the game it sends a message about not finding INVERT_EXTERNAL_PAN and NO_FOV_RESET lines added by bob.exe to bdg.txt file). Maybe more codes were added to "bob.exe" version 2.0.2.0 so removing them the compatibility bug to modern systems will be definitively solved
I also made some more tests using other patches and the results were the following:
-Patch 2.02 using "bob.exe" file from 2.01 (Full Stable)
-Patch 2.03 using "bob.exe" file from 2.01 (Full Stable with some Visual glitches)
-Patch 2.04 using "bob.exe" file from 2.01 (Full Stable but with many sound bugs)
-Patch 2.05 to 2.13 using "bob.exe" file from 2.01 (Game doesn't even start sending bob.exe error message)
p.s: Full Stable means the game doesn't crash during gameplay (Tested on Heavy Missions like Historic "Eagle Day" or "London" using max video settings)
The problem is simply the file "bob.exe" from patches 2.02 to 2.13
I'm sure the addition of one of these 3 following codes to "bob.exe" is making the game to crash:
TRACKIR6DOF
INVERT_EXTERNAL_PAN
NO_FOV_RESET
Cause if you install patch 2.02 but use with it the "bob.exe" file from patch 2.01 the game runs perfectly. (But when you exit the game it sends a message about not finding INVERT_EXTERNAL_PAN and NO_FOV_RESET lines added by bob.exe to bdg.txt file). Maybe more codes were added to "bob.exe" version 2.0.2.0 so removing them the compatibility bug to modern systems will be definitively solved
I also made some more tests using other patches and the results were the following:
-Patch 2.02 using "bob.exe" file from 2.01 (Full Stable)
-Patch 2.03 using "bob.exe" file from 2.01 (Full Stable with some Visual glitches)
-Patch 2.04 using "bob.exe" file from 2.01 (Full Stable but with many sound bugs)
-Patch 2.05 to 2.13 using "bob.exe" file from 2.01 (Game doesn't even start sending bob.exe error message)
p.s: Full Stable means the game doesn't crash during gameplay (Tested on Heavy Missions like Historic "Eagle Day" or "London" using max video settings)
"Just wanna live enough to tell my grandson I was a BOB2 Ace"
-
- Airman
- Posts: 26
- Joined: 06 Dec 2017, 17:46
Re: Guide to Run BOB2 Perfectly with Max Settings on Windows
This sounds so very close...
Now I wish even more the devs would give it another look.
Or at least someone skilled enough to fix it...
Maybe you are
Now I wish even more the devs would give it another look.
Or at least someone skilled enough to fix it...
Maybe you are
Re: Guide to Run BOB2 Perfectly with Max Settings on Windows
Yes man very close, at least the bug position has been spoted, we only need now the coders to take a look. I wish I could do that myself but it seems the codes inside "bob.exe" file are in a strange format that can't be edited by non devs crew.
I opened bob.exe file using software "PE Explorer" and it's possible to edit a lot of content like dialog and strings but the main Codes part is hidden so only developers could fix it.
I opened bob.exe file using software "PE Explorer" and it's possible to edit a lot of content like dialog and strings but the main Codes part is hidden so only developers could fix it.
"Just wanna live enough to tell my grandson I was a BOB2 Ace"
Re: Guide to Run BOB2 Perfectly with Max Settings on Windows 8.1
So with the above tips, can you play the BOB II campaign with V 2.01on Win 10?
Re: Guide to Run BOB2 Perfectly with Max Settings on Windows 8.1
Hi, BOB2 Patches above 2.01 have two main bugs on modern systems:
-On Windows 8 and 8.1 it has the "Crash to Desktop" bug during all kind of missions Instant Action and Campaign.
-On Windows 10 it has the same "Crash to Desktop" bug plus a bug when you quit a mission using command "alt+X" (Windows 8 and 8.1 don't have this alt+x bug)
Patch 2.01 works perfectly on Windows 8.1 using Windows XP compatibility mode but on Windows 10 I'm not sure if it will fix the "alt+x" bug... So maybe changing the "EXITKEY" to any other key could solve but it needs someone with Windows 10 to test it. On campaing you can continue or end a mission pressing "1" or "2" keys but only when you finish the mission after land your plane and turn off engines. So I'm curious to know if the game still crashes pressing "2" on Campaign too.
-On Windows 8 and 8.1 it has the "Crash to Desktop" bug during all kind of missions Instant Action and Campaign.
-On Windows 10 it has the same "Crash to Desktop" bug plus a bug when you quit a mission using command "alt+X" (Windows 8 and 8.1 don't have this alt+x bug)
Patch 2.01 works perfectly on Windows 8.1 using Windows XP compatibility mode but on Windows 10 I'm not sure if it will fix the "alt+x" bug... So maybe changing the "EXITKEY" to any other key could solve but it needs someone with Windows 10 to test it. On campaing you can continue or end a mission pressing "1" or "2" keys but only when you finish the mission after land your plane and turn off engines. So I'm curious to know if the game still crashes pressing "2" on Campaign too.
"Just wanna live enough to tell my grandson I was a BOB2 Ace"
-
- Airman
- Posts: 26
- Joined: 06 Dec 2017, 17:46
Re: Guide to Run BOB2 Perfectly with Max Settings on Windows 8.1
I tried on W10 - seemed to work.
BUT BoBIIWoV has progressed so much between 2.01 and 2.13 - it seems like a diffrent game.
While I would love to fully play 2.13 (played instant actions with ctd at alt-x and a campaign as pure wargame) - this could be my favourite flight sim! But 2.01 is just not worth it - flight behaviour feels wrong, the game looks much worse, the flight behaviour of AI looks unnatural and the AI is not nearly as good as in 2.13 - and the campaign itself is not as refined...
So I'll unfortunatly stick to other games - it's a pitty noone at a2a cares about getting this to run on modern systems.
BUT BoBIIWoV has progressed so much between 2.01 and 2.13 - it seems like a diffrent game.
While I would love to fully play 2.13 (played instant actions with ctd at alt-x and a campaign as pure wargame) - this could be my favourite flight sim! But 2.01 is just not worth it - flight behaviour feels wrong, the game looks much worse, the flight behaviour of AI looks unnatural and the AI is not nearly as good as in 2.13 - and the campaign itself is not as refined...
So I'll unfortunatly stick to other games - it's a pitty noone at a2a cares about getting this to run on modern systems.
Re: Guide to Run BOB2 Perfectly with Max Settings on Windows 8.1
I too wish it would run on a modern system. I tried to do a dual boot with Win 10 and Win 7, but it didn't work. I have a thread on that in the tech support forum.
Re: Guide to Run BOB2 Perfectly with Max Settings on Windows 8.1
hello, I find Felizpe's idea interesting and I will carry out tests under Windows 10, but I am only waiting for my order for the BoB2 DVD ROM to arriveFelizpe wrote: ↑26 May 2019, 11:29 Hi, BOB2 Patches above 2.01 have two main bugs on modern systems:
-On Windows 8 and 8.1 it has the "Crash to Desktop" bug during all kind of missions Instant Action and Campaign.
-On Windows 10 it has the same "Crash to Desktop" bug plus a bug when you quit a mission using command "alt+X" (Windows 8 and 8.1 don't have this alt+x bug)
Patch 2.01 works perfectly on Windows 8.1 using Windows XP compatibility mode but on Windows 10 I'm not sure if it will fix the "alt+x" bug... So maybe changing the "EXITKEY" to any other key could solve but it needs someone with Windows 10 to test it. On campaing you can continue or end a mission pressing "1" or "2" keys but only when you finish the mission after land your plane and turn off engines. So I'm curious to know if the game still crashes pressing "2" on Campaign too.
I'm not a programmer, I say that in passing... but I can always try with all the advice already given in this forum
A pity that this discussion thread (may 2019) has not since been contributed by other BoB2 players under Windows 10, because I would like to benefit from version 2.13 in its entirety
Re: Guide to Run BOB2 Perfectly with Max Settings on Windows 8.1
jarods, From current testing , BOB2: WOV runs perfectly on PC with W7/64 and V2.13.
On W8, W10 and W11 BOBII patch v2.01 seems to run perfectly however, V2.02 through V2.13 frequently CTD on exiting via AltX. as described by Felizpe. Efforts are underway to try and get v2.13 running on Win 11
See:
https://a2asimulations.com/forum/viewtopic.php?t=75898
Note: There are different patch versions on disk media and through direct Downloads. ( e.g. Some disks are 2.0 others 2.04 etc. )
Hope this helps clarify.
On W8, W10 and W11 BOBII patch v2.01 seems to run perfectly however, V2.02 through V2.13 frequently CTD on exiting via AltX. as described by Felizpe. Efforts are underway to try and get v2.13 running on Win 11
See:
https://a2asimulations.com/forum/viewtopic.php?t=75898
Note: There are different patch versions on disk media and through direct Downloads. ( e.g. Some disks are 2.0 others 2.04 etc. )
Hope this helps clarify.
Re: Guide to Run BOB2 Perfectly with Max Settings on Windows 8.1
Hi Vox Thanks for the interesting link i Will read with interestVox wrote: ↑08 Feb 2024, 08:22
See:
https://a2asimulations.com/forum/viewtopic.php?t=75898
Note: There are different patch versions on disk media and through direct Downloads. ( e.g. Some disks are 2.0 others 2.04 etc. )
Hope this helps clarify.
My original cd rom i finally found is in 2.03 version
Who is online
Users browsing this forum: Amazon [Bot] and 33 guests